Marilyn Monroe is one of Hollywood’s most beloved icons. Her effortless beauty, charm, and timeless appeal have left an indelible mark on pop culture. In Palm Springs, a statue of the legendary actress stands as a larger-than-life tribute to her captivating presence—immortalizing the allure of the blonde bombshell in one of the most scenic and culturally rich areas of California.

The 26’ statue weighs 34,000 lbs. and glorifies one of Marilyn’s most iconic film moments. Marilyn is shown in a white dress from the 1955 film “Seven Year Itch.” While standing on a subway grate in New York City a gust of air lifts her skirt and has become one of the most recognized photos in film history.

The statue was created by Seward Johnson known for trompe-l’œil painted bronze statues. He was a grandson of Robert Wood Johnson I, the co-founder of Johnson & Johnson and has many other larger than life works scattered in Museums, private collections and in public displays. He is best known for his realistic depictions of real people in life sized figures.

Palm Springs was once the haven for the Hollywood film stars. The weather, stunning mountain backdrop and proximity to Los Angeles made Palm Springs the go-to destination for celebrities looking for fun and a change of scenery. Monroe was a regular in Palm Springs, particularly in the 1950s, when she was married to Joe DiMaggio of baseball fame. Although she never owned property here, she would rent the Elizabeth Taylor Estate occasionally. This statue is a reminder to all of the significance of Palm Springs to the film stars of the past.

As you may already be aware the statue was recently moved from in front of the Palm Springs Art Museum to a plot in nearby Downtown Park. Before the move it was estimated that around 90,000 people a month visited the site. Remarkably, the new location is only about 100 feet from its original spot. This impressive and controversial artwork has become a must-see attraction for residents and tourists alike. The statue captures the essence of the star’s magnetic charm and allure, and serves as a testament to her lasting impact on American popular culture. Tourists come to have their photo taken beneath the statue and applaud the scale of the sculpture.

Marilyn’s impact on modern culture cannot be overstated. She became a sex symbol, a symbol of glamour and of the complexities of fame. Her image in Palm Springs is a celebration of her life, her career and her lasting impact on the world.
